Understanding Your Vehicle’s Transmission System

Your car’s transmission is a complex system responsible for transferring power from the engine to the wheels. It ensures the right amount of power goes to your wheels while driving at different speeds. When this system malfunctions, seeking a transmission repair service becomes essential. A well-functioning transmission enhances your vehicle’s performance and longevity.

DIY Fixes Aren’t Always the Solution

In today’s digital age, it’s easy to find do-it-yourself guides for almost anything, including car repairs. However, many DIY fixes for transmission issues may lack critical insight or tools needed to address deeper problems effectively. Attempting such repairs without proper knowledge could worsen the situation or nullify any existing warranties on your vehicle.

Understanding Transmission Fluid Needs

Many believe that transmission fluid never needs changing. However, like engine oil, this fluid degrades over time and must be replaced as per your vehicle manufacturer’s guidelines. Neglecting this simple task can result in poor shifting performance or even transmission failure.
